The nature and characteristics of the course "International Trade Practice" is a discipline specializing in the specific process of international commodity exchange, a comprehensive applied science with strong practicality and the characteristics of foreign activities. It involves the application of basic principles and knowledge of international trade theory and policy, international trade law and practice, international finance, international transportation and insurance. International trade is different from domestic trade, and its trading process, trading conditions, trading practices and related issues are far more complicated than domestic trade. Specific manifestations: ① The parties to the transaction are located in different countries and regions, and in the process of negotiation and performance, different systems, policies, measures, laws, conventions and customary practices are involved, and the situation is complicated. A slight negligence may affect the smooth realization of economic interests. There are many intermediate links in international trade, involving a wide range, including commodity inspection, transportation, insurance, finance, stations, ports, customs, as well as various middlemen and agents. If something goes wrong, it will affect the normal conduct of the whole transaction and may cause legal disputes. In addition, in international trade, the transaction volume between the two parties is usually relatively large, and the traded goods may be affected by various external risks such as natural disasters and accidents during transportation. Therefore, it is usually necessary to take out various insurances to avoid or reduce economic losses. (3) The international market is vast, the parties to the transaction are far apart, and the situation of employees in the international trade circle is complex, which is prone to fraudulent activities. If you are not careful, you may be cheated, and the payment will be empty, causing serious economic losses. (4) International trade is vulnerable to changes in objective conditions such as policies and economic situation, especially in the current turbulent international situation, intensified competition and trade friction in the international market, frequent exchange rate fluctuations in the international market, and rapidly changing commodity prices, the instability of international trade is more obvious and it is more difficult to engage in international trade. It can be seen that international trade has the characteristics of long line, wide area, many links, great difficulty and rapid change. Therefore, anyone engaged in international trade should not only master the basic principles, knowledge, skills and methods of international trade, but also learn the ability to analyze and deal with practical business problems to ensure the smooth realization of social and economic benefits. (2) Pay attention to the relationship between business and law. The content of the course of international trade law is closely related to the content of the course of international trade practice, because the establishment of an international contract for the sale of goods must go through certain legal steps, and an international contract for the sale of goods is a binding legal document for both parties. Performing a contract is a legal act, and dealing with disputes in performance is actually solving legal disputes. Moreover, countries with different legal systems have different results of specific rulings. This requires learning the content of this course from both practical and legal aspects. (4) Pay attention to the connection between this course and other related courses. International trade practice is a comprehensive subject, which is closely related to other courses. In the process of teaching and learning, we should make comprehensive use of our knowledge. For example, when it comes to the quality, quantity and packaging content of goods, it is necessary to understand the subject knowledge of goods; When it comes to commodity prices, we should understand the contents of price science, international finance and monetary banking; When it comes to international cargo transportation and insurance, it is necessary to understand the contents of transportation and insurance disciplines; When talking about disputes, breach of contract, claims, force majeure and other contents, we should understand the relevant legal knowledge and so on. (5) Implementing the principle of "making foreign things serve China" In order to meet the needs of the development of international trade, international organizations such as the International Chamber of Commerce have successively formulated various rules related to international trade, such as General Rules for the Interpretation of International Trade Terms, Uniform Rules for Collection and Uniform Customs and Practice for Documentary Letters of Credit. These rules have become recognized general international trade practices in current international trade, widely accepted and frequently used by people, and become the code of conduct for practitioners in international trade. Therefore, when studying this course, we must follow the principle of "making foreign things serve China", combine our national conditions, learn some internationally accepted practices and principles, and learn to use some effective international trade methods and practices flexibly, so as to act according to international norms in trade practice and speed up the integration with the international market.
